href="https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Ej6E}; document.write('');w5Wr0yTN97RWb1dkVxu7TFWXATam4OFRuWV1Oa1uzLRiTxdrU8y6LhjZTmnpKhW88KgzU7AanpJzyGf_RNubqSQMbnAMG757rLILTMNq2LWObxgk41a-Jl6OW2NzTxnSAayXYbptdj99y5Xo3-zJnMNGCWqGz9wENaqbm3tnCePLgoNmPdsi6Z_yDU/s188/foxpro-200x160.webp" imageanchor="1" style="margin-left: 1em; margin-right: 1em;"> Unleashing the Power of a Traditional Relational Database Management System by Building a Comprehensive Visual FoxPro



Summary of Contents




Introduction


What is Visual FoxPro, firstly?


b. A Synopsis of Visual FoxPro's History


Why Opt for Visual FoxPro?


Setting up Visual FoxPro


A Summary of the Visual FoxPro Interface (e.




Beginning with Visual FoxPro


Building Your First Database


b. Fields and Tables


Data Entry and Editing c


d. Establishing connections between tables


Indicating Performance


SQL and queries in Visual FoxPro

A. Using SQL to Perform Data Queries B. Using the Query Designer to Build Queries


c. SQL Expressions and Functions


Combining Information from Different Tables


Advanced Query Methodologies




The user interface and forms


Building Forms That Are User-Friendly


Creating Form Layouts


c. Data Binding and Adding Controls


d. Error handling and Form Validation


e. Designing Personal Toolbars and Menus




Printing and Reports


Making Reports a.

b. Data Binding and Report Controls

c. Data Grouping and Summarization


d. Reports Printing and Exporting


e. Changing the Report Output




Features of Programmatic in Visual FoxPro


Introduction to VFP Programming


b. Programming and Executing Code


c. Data Types and Variables


d. Loops and conditional statements


e. Debugging and error handling




Development of Advanced Databases


Working with Cursors and Views


b. Updates and Data Manipulation


c. Stored Procedures and Triggers


d. Improving Query and Index Performance


e. Moving Data Between Visual FoxPro and Other Programs

Connectivity and Integration

a. External Data Source Connections b. ODBC and Data Import/Export


Automating Activities Using Outside Programs


Integration of Visual FoxPro with the Web


VFP and contemporary technologies




Visual FoxPro Techniques and Tips


Performance Enhancement Techniques


b. Effective Coding Techniques


The best practices for deploying applications


d. Version Management and Teamwork


Maintaining Your Visual FoxPro Knowledge


Resources and Continuing Education

Books and online classes; Visual FoxPro forums and community


c. Training Programs and Certifications


d. YouTube Channels and Blogs


Projects from the Real World and Case Studies




Conclusion




Despite its age, Visual FoxPro is still a powerful tool for managing and creating databases. Your go-to resource for unlocking Visual FoxPro's full potential is this in-depth blog post. This blog will provide you with the knowledge and abilities required to build reliable database applications, regardless of whether you are an experienced developer or a newcomer to the platform.


Each section offers in-depth insights and useful examples to improve your proficiency with Visual FoxPro, covering everything from database design to user interface development and from SQL queries to advanced programming. You'll learn that Visual FoxPro can be a useful tool in a variety of industries and applications as you investigate its various aspects and work on practical projects.

Keep in mind that mastery of Visual FoxPro, like any technology, requires practice and ongoing learning. Stay curious, experiment with different features, and refer to this blog whenever needed. Even though Visual FoxPro is a classic, it can still be a useful and efficient tool in your toolbox for database development. Happy Visual FoxPro coding!

1. GitHub - VFPX/VFPInstallers: Providers installers for VFP components: service packs, ODBC driver, OLE DB provider, runtimes, HTML Help Workshop

2. Download Visual FoxPro 9.0 Service Pack 2 Rollup Update from Official Microsoft Download Center